For his surprise proposal, Nick planned a romantic weekend trip up north at a lodge in the Kawarthas for Gwen's birthday. On the Sunday, after a day of snow-shoeing, skating and laughing at each other's outdoorsy skills (or lack thereof), Nick rushed Gwen back to their room so they could catch the sunset. "Knowing he wanted to propose, Nick had us upgraded to a room that boasted the best views of the sunset," recalls Gwen. "He lit a fire and surprised me by pulling an ice bucket and Veuve out from a hiding spot. I didn't think anything of it since it was the day after my birthday." Gwen didn't think twice when he pulled out a box of fancy chocolates from their favourite local shop, Ambiance in Toronto's Leslieville. "He asked me to dig through the box to find this jalapeño flavour they had told him was delicious, so I did, and there was a ring box!" Gwen exclaims. "The best part was that he caught the entire proposal on video from his iPhone, which he had casually placed on a staircase hoping it would at least catch the audio." Luckily, it framed the couple perfectly with the sunset in the background. "We've watched it a couple of times since then, and it's such a great memento to have."

For their autumn wedding, Nick and Gwen opted for a chic, vintage theme with lots of antique copper and brass vases, burlap and twine, mixing in polished accents like black and cream ribbon and all-white flowers. Their ceremony and reception were held at St. Lawrence Market in Toronto, which provided the perfect atmosphere for their antique motif. Gwen's favourite moment of the day was when her mom ironed her wedding dress while she was wearing it! "As there were no outlets in the bathrooms, we stood in the hallway of the St. Lawrence Market," laughs Gwen.
